Dead CR 2016 3V button battery
I recently bought a 2 battery pack for my remote. Upon installing the battery, it didn't work. I changed batteries, and the second one also didn't work. I thought something was wrong with my remote. I pulled out my voltmeter and checked the voltage on both batteries. 1.5V??? Further tests revealed that it maintained a solid 1.5v. I googled the battery and found quite a few people complaining about their "dead" batteries. I think the problem may be that 1.5 batteries were erroneously packaged as 3V. Beware!
